1220111000611 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 1220111000612. Its totient is φ = 1220111000610.
The previous prime is 1220111000561. The next prime is 1220111000657. The reversal of 1220111000611 is 1160001110221.
It is a strong prime.
It is an emirp because it is prime and its reverse (1160001110221) is a distict pr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 1220111000611 - 29 = 1220111000099 is a prime.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(1220111007611)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 610055500305 + 610055500306.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(610055500306).
Almost surely, 21220111000611 is an apocalyptic number.
1220111000611 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
1220111000611 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
1220111000611 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 24, while the sum is 16.
Adding to 1220111000611 its reverse (1160001110221), we get a palindrome (2380112110832).
The spelling of 1220111000611 in words is "one trillion, two hundred twenty billion, one hundred eleven million, six hundred eleven", and thus it is an aban number.
